A Quick Trip Down Memory Lane
Microsoft’s journey began in a small garage in Albuquerque, New Mexico. Sounds like the start of a classic tech success story, right? The company’s first big break came with MS-DOS, an operating system that laid the groundwork for personal computing in the 1980s. But the real game-changer was the launch of Windows in 1985. Suddenly, computers became more accessible to everyday users, and Microsoft cemented its place as a leader in the tech world.

Windows: The Operating System That Changed Everything
If you’ve ever used a PC, chances are you’ve interacted with Windows. Starting with Windows 1.0 (which, let’s be honest, was pretty basic by today’s standards), the operating system has evolved into the sleek, user-friendly Windows 10 and the highly anticipated Windows 11. Despite competition from macOS and Linux, Windows still dominates the desktop OS market. It’s like the Swiss Army knife of operating systems—versatile, reliable, and always evolving.

Microsoft Azure: The Cloud Computing Giant
In the age of the cloud, Microsoft isn’t just keeping up—it’s leading the charge. Microsoft Azure is the company’s answer to the growing demand for cloud services. From hosting websites to running complex AI algorithms, Azure provides businesses with the tools they need to innovate and scale. It’s like having a virtual data center at your fingertips, and it’s giving competitors like Amazon Web Services (AWS) a run for their money.
Xbox: Gaming Done Right
Gamers, rejoice! Microsoft’s Xbox brand has been a major player in the gaming industry for decades. From the original Xbox to the latest Xbox Series X and S, the company has consistently pushed the boundaries of console gaming. And let’s not forget Xbox Game Pass, a subscription service that gives players access to a massive library of games. It’s like Netflix, but for gamers—and it’s a big reason why Microsoft remains a favorite among gaming enthusiasts.
